Job Summary

The Regional Facilities Program Manager supports facilities programs and projects across multiple sites. This role focuses on project coordination, facilities quoting, cost modeling, budgeting, forecasting, and cross-functional collaboration from project initiation through closeout.

What a typical day looks like:

  • Develop project schedules, financial parameters, and requirements from initiation through closeout.
  • Track and manage facilities projects across multiple sites and regions.
  • Prepare and distribute status, financial, and process reports; support executive‑level presentations.
  • Work with relevant teams to prepare forecasts and budgets for facilities‑related accounts.
  • Track and manage project budgets for facilities and development activities, including CapEx and OpEx.
  • Compare actual costs against forecasts and approved quotes; research variances, ensure required adjustment postings are completed, and collect business justifications for remaining variances for reporting purposes.
  • Participate in quote strategy discussions and attend quote kick‑off calls as required.
  • Receive, review, and distribute all facilities quotation materials to relevant teams.
  • Complete detailed cost models for each facilities quote, ensuring correct processes, content, and validation of assumptions with Business teams and Operations.
  • Create cost models for budgetary or quick‑turn facilities quotes when required.
  • Coordinate quoting activities, including multi‑site and multi‑regional facilities quotations.
  • Maintain clear, accurate, and auditable records of all facilities quotations and supporting documentation.
  • Travel to other site locations as needed to provide program and facilities support.
